14) Excess intake of Niacin is the cause of painful flushed feeling in face.
Niacin cause small blood vessel dilation,so it increases blood flow to
that area of skin and cause flushing.
15) Niacin rich foods are
* Chicken.
* Peanut butter.
* Orange juice .
* Mushrooms.
